Insurance Premiums Comparison for Drinkers and Smokers vs. Non-Drinkers and Non-Smokers:
When it comes to life insurance, non-drinkers and non-smokers benefit from significantly lower premiums. A 25-year-old non-drinker/non-smoker in India might pay an annual premium of around ₹10,000–₹12,000 (Approx.) for a ₹1 crore life insurance policy. In contrast, for individuals who smoke or consume alcohol, insurers typically charge 25-50% more due to the heightened health risks associated with these habits. This results in an annual premium range of approximately ₹12,500–₹18,000 (Approx.), depending on the frequency and intensity of these behaviors.
In addition to life insurance, health insurance policies are also more costly for smokers and drinkers. Insurers may either charge a higher premium or impose stricter conditions, such as exclusions for certain illnesses directly related to these habits. This financial disparity underscores the hidden costs of lifestyle choices, where smoking or drinking can lead to long-term financial burdens beyond just monthly spending.
